Introducing Freeman’s—America’s Auction House since 1805 The prestige of Freeman’s, Cowan’s, and Hindman—now united under one timeless name. This November, the company will move forward simply as Freeman’s, honoring its historic legacy. The rebrand coincides with the 220th anniversary of its founding in November 1805, when Tristram B. Freeman was appointed auctioneer for the City of Philadelphia. For more than two centuries, Freeman’s has connected people with extraordinary objects. This next chapter brings together the firm’s combined history, experience, and national reach under one trusted name. Though the brand has evolved, the commitment to clients remains unchanged: to provide exceptional service and expertise at every step.

Books & Manuscripts, Including Americana

Freeman’s August 20, 2026, Books & Manuscripts, Including Americana sale highlights the continued celebration of the 250th anniversary of the founding of America. It includes important documents related to the American Revolution, Presidential history, the African-American experience, fine works of literature, natural history, and much more. The sale is led by an extremely rare 1781 French loan document printed and signed by Benjamin Franklin and used to help fund the American Revolution (est. $200,000-$300,000); a first edition of The Book of Mormon ($100,000-$150,000); and two very important letters signed by President George Washington, one transmitting the first major law passed by Congress ($100,000-$150,000), and the other reaffirming the American Treaty of Friendship with Morocco ($50,000-$80,000). Other highlights include the Surveying Commission of the Continental Congress settling the New York/Massachusetts border ($30,000-$50,000); a very rare book signed by famed astrophysicist Stephen Hawking ($15,000-$25,000); a rare letter signed by early African-American businessman Paul Cuffe ($15,000-$25,000); autograph notes in the hand of Dr. Charles A. Leale, the first physician on site after the assassination of Abraham Lincoln ($12,000-$18,000); a large collection of printed and manuscript documents fresh to market from Rev. Samuel J. May, a founding member of the New England Anti-Slavery Society in the 1830s, and a lifetime ardent supporter of the abolitionist movement.
